Giter Club home page Giter Club logo

resu-me's Introduction

Craft your professional journey with ease ๐Ÿ“„โœจ

resu-me

Description:

resu-me is a dynamic resume generator designed to simplify and enhance the process of spinning up professional resumes. Whether you're a seasoned professional or just starting, resu-me makes it easy to produce polished and personalized resumes that stand out. Note: The development of resu-me leans towards applicants for technical roles. However, usage is open to all applicants.

Check out the live version here: resu-me Demo.

Key Features

  • Customizable Sections: Add and modify sections like education, experience, skills, and projects to suit your professional background.
  • Interactive Preview: See real-time updates as you build your CV, ensuring every detail is just right.
  • Mobile Responsive Design: Craft your resume on any device with an interface optimized for both desktop and mobile.

Technical Details

Technologies Used

  • React: A JavaScript library for building user interfaces, allowing resu-me to have a dynamic and responsive frontend.
  • Vite: An incredibly fast frontend build tool, enhancing the development experience with features like Hot Module Replacement (HMR).

Dynamic Form Handling

resu-me employs robust form handling to capture and organize your professional data efficiently, ensuring a smooth user experience.

Responsive Design

Tailored for flexibility, resu-me adapts to various screen sizes, making it accessible and user-friendly across all devices.

Getting Started

Prerequisites

  • Node.js v21.6.2

Installation

npm install

Running the Project

For development:

npm run dev

For production:

npm run build

Usage and Examples

  1. Input Your Details: Fill in your information across various sections like General, Education, Experience, etc.
  2. Customize Your Layout: Arrange sections as per your preference, and watch the live preview update instantly.
  3. (Coming soon) Export as PDF: Once satisfied with the layout and content, export your CV as a PDF, ready to be shared.

Contribution and Support

Contributing

resu-me is open to contributions. Whether it's a feature suggestion, bug report, or code contribution, your input is valuable. Feel free to fork the repository, try it out, and share your findings.

Please read CONTRIBUTING.md for details on our code of conduct, and the process for submitting pull requests to us.

Support

For support or to report issues, contact me at [email protected].

Acknowledgements and References

This project utilizes resources from Tailwind CSS and Vite documentation, UI Colors' Tailwind CSS Color Generator for styling, Netlify for deployment, along with third-party libraries like react-phone-number-input, react-tooltip and the MUI X component library.

Resume template and tips are referenced from r/cscareerquestions and r/EngineeringResumes.

License

This project is licensed under the MIT License - see the LICENSE.md file for details

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.